Recycling A Mistake..........Hope!

If you haven't visited me before you won't be aware that I have been struggling recently with Less Is More.

This card is an idea I had which didn't work following Less Is More guidelines (I tend to embellish/layer and stitch a lot ... I also love texture!) so it was out of my comfort zone ... The Challenge Card is Here if you want a peek.

This was the Less Is More Reject which just didn't look right but I tried to salvage and this is the result.

Just so you know the mistake is under the layer ... amazing what you can do with a Spellbinders Die lol!

So the Background was stamped with my Stampin' Up! Hope Set, Shimmer Spritzed and embossed with a Cuttlebug Embossing Folder (I think it's Victoria but I'm sure you'll let me know if it isn't) .. I embossed it and then flattened it again through the Bigshot so the embossing wouldn't be deep so there would only be a little texture.

As I had to cover the original mistake this layer was stamped first using the Hope Set and Hero Arts Soft Sand Shadow Ink Pad ... I also stamped the Butterfly underneath as a shadow.
A little stitching around the edge of the Spellbinder embossed layer and once I attached the Butterfly (Worn Lipstick Distress Ink) I added the pearls.

Here's a close-up of the Martha Stewart Punched Butterfly ... the gems have been added to stick the Butterfly to the Card but I also added some strands of cotton on the back and secured with Glossy Accents to make sure it wouldn't fly anywhere lol!

Trying to show you the Shimmer ... Unfortunately the photograph looks a little bit yellow as the camera didn't pick up the Shimmer very well.

Well which is your favourite ... my Less Is More Option or this one.

Less is More Continued.........Wish!

I would like to thank Marrigje who had me thinking outside the box on this one and gave me the idea and inspiration to create my next card for the Less Is More One Word Challenge.

Still using my Metallic Silver and Teal Colourway .. I really enjoyed this one and it came together quite quickly.

I already had some pre-cut Sizzix Scallop Cards so I first of all added the Tim Holtz Wish Word Cut and then carefully placed the Snowflake I wanted as I had to cut it separately ... the Die is Here so you can see how carefully I had to cut.

Then I stamped the Stampin' Up! Serene Snowflakes ... Spritzed with Vanilla Shimmer and again embossed with my Kars Snowflake Embossing Folder.

The Gems were then added.

Another view and a peek at the inside ...... Yes I stamped a Snowflake on the inside using my Stamp-a-majig so that when you close the card the Snowflake is in the correct postition.

A Challenge Missed............

.............but the inspiration image over at The Play Date Cafe caught my eye and I just had to have a go.

I've used Metallic Silver in my card instead of Black.

I had an idea what to use straight away but I'm not sure if I like it now as I think I lost something in translation from what I envisaged to what actually appeared on the card.

I stamped my HA Fabulous Flourish a few times with Metallic Silver Ink and decided to make a set of two Cards (the third image stamped too light but that's another Post lol!)

Here is a close-up of the card.

The Snowflake is made using Sizzix Dies ... I inked the teal layer with an old ink pad ... The top Snowflake layer has been stamped with an SU Snowflake Stamp ... I have I then sprayed with Vanilla Shimmer Smoosh Spritz ... attached the pieces together with foam pads and attached the gem.

After stamping the background of the card with my HA Fabulous Flourish, I then stamped the HOTP 'Tis the Season' with the Teal Ink .. Then I sprayed with Vanilla Shimmer and once dry embossed with my Kars Snowflake Embossing Folder ... lastly I attached the gems.

Unfortunately it hasn't photographed well so you can't see the lovely Shimmer.
